AI Ops Manager Co., Ltd. has launched “AOM Prime,” an OEM-type service that provides thorough support for launching AI implementation support businesses, starting in April 2026.
AOM Prime is an OEM package that provides our proprietary AI talent database and industry-specific, proven AI implementation scenarios and sales materials. Partner companies can develop AI implementation support businesses under their own brand, and we handle the backend (service infrastructure, talent database, operations management) and sales support, enabling service launch in as little as one week.
Background
As “AI Ops Manager,” we have assigned AI talent to numerous clients, including major corporations, achieving a 100% retention rate (as of April 2026). Based on this track record, we designed AOM Prime as a system that enables partner companies to develop their AI businesses by leveraging their respective industry and customer bases.

While the need for AI utilization among companies is rapidly expanding, many companies still face the challenge of “understanding the necessity of AI utilization, but lacking personnel with strong AI skills to drive it forward.”
Furthermore, for AI implementation to truly demonstrate its value, knowledge of AI utilization alone is insufficient; expertise in the industry itself and its specific operations is extremely important.
We believe that the most effective way to spread AI among Japanese companies is to partner with companies that have a strong customer network rooted in the industry.
